Product description The Ascent® Posterior Occipital Cervical Thoracic System allows surgeons to address complicated fusion cases from the base of the skull to the thoracic region. While the occipital plate enables fixation to the occiput, the detailed engineering of the multi-axial screws and cross connectors simplify the procedure. The multi-axial screws feature 66 degrees of angulation which minimizes rod contouring. The multi-plane adjustable cross connectors are pre-assembled and utilize a drop-in design for easy insertion. Features & Benefits Surgeon Benefits Occipital anchor plates accommodate varying patient anatomies 66 degrees of angulation maximize range of motion & minimizes rod contouring No-assembly cross connector provides multi-plane adjustability: translation, rotation and angulation Connectors enable extended construct from thoracic to lumbar Strength and Flexibility With four plate widths (31, 37, 45 and 50 mm), the Occipital Anchor Plates accommodate varying patient anatomies Four points of fixation to the occiput provide added security Occipital Plate enables fixation to extend to occiput 4 points of fixation
